Bank staff helped bust crime gang that laundered £1.5m using foreign students’ bank accounts
Officers spotted drug traffickers delivering bags of cash to the gang's safe house after Santander workers noticed a suspicious pattern of transfers.

Profits at JD Wetherspoon sunk 19 per cent in the six months to the end of January, its latest results show. The pub chain, run by prominent Brexiteer Tim Martin, blamed a rise in labour costs, interest payments, utility bills, repairs and depreciation for the fall. Martin is currently touring 100 ...
John Laing Environmental Assets Group – Life extensions to boost NAV? John Laing Environmental Assets Group (JLEN) says its NAV per share at the end of December 2018 was 102.8p, up 2.4p over three months. The quarterly dividend payments remain on-track to match the target of 6.51p for the year. The company’s revenue ...
